Isabelle Ertmann (* 1954 ; † May 13, 2015 in Berlin ) was a German actress and theater educator .

life and career

After her private acting training with Marlise Ludwig and Erika Dannhoff , she was a permanent member of the ensemble at Theater Baden-Baden for years , where she took part in plays such as Mother Courage and Her Children , the Threepenny Opera and The Good Man of Sezuan . Since then she can be found regularly on various stages in Germany, including at the Erfurt Theater or the Hansa-Theater Berlin.

After appearing in the Tatort episode Blasslila Briefe , she was involved in other film and television productions, such as the television series Kanzlei Bürger , Dr. Sommerfeld - News from the Bülowbogen , our Charly or big city area . In the multi-part Molle mit Korn , filmed based on Georg Lentz , she played the role of Wanda. She also starred in films like Mother at 16 or Moon Calf .
